摘要
Introduction: We report the case of a neonate diagnosed with severe hemophilia A (HA) and conduct a literature review of cases of severe HA presenting at the neonatal age to help define the clinical diagnostic findings and existing differences between the sporadic and familial onset of this condition. Report of a Case: A 6-day-old newborn presented with worsening pallor, inappetence, and hyporeactivity for 48 h. The diagnosis was severe hemophilia A (HA), leading to an unfavorable outcome. A literature review focusing on case reports and series focusing on the clinical expression of HA in neonates was conducted, documenting clinical presentation, family history, and outcomes. Literature review: Forty patients were included. HA was observed in five cases (12.5%) of very preterm births (<= 32 weeks) and in four cases (10%) of moderately or late preterm births. Seventeen patients (43%) had a family history, with inheritance being sporadic (21 newborns, 53%) or acquired (2 cases, 4%). Clinical onset typically occurred within the first week of life (approximately 8 out of 10 cases), while only three cases (7.5%) had onset after the first month. Inherited cases presented with hemorrhagic states (nine cases), hypovolemic shock (five cases), or intracranial hypertension (two cases). Sporadic cases showed localized bleeding (11 cases), hypovolemic shock (5 cases), or neurological symptoms like seizures and anisocoria (5 cases). Acquired cases included severe intracranial hemorrhage in one case. Conclusions: Neonatal HA can manifest with severe symptoms and rapid progression, making early diagnosis crucial. Non-specific signs and the absence of coagulophaty disorders in family history can delay diagnosis. Symptoms like prolonged bleeding, cutaneous hematomas, or intracranial bleeding necessitate ruling out major coagulopathy, and neurological signs require immediate imaging to exclude intracranial bleeding.
